EDEN PRAIRIE, Minn. (AP) — The Minnesota Vikings have made linemen and linebackers their top draft targets.

For the fourth time in the last five years, the Vikings accumulated 10 picks over the seven rounds through various trades.

They took three tackles: T.J. Clemmings in the fourth round from Pittsburgh, Tyrus Thompson in the sixth round from Oklahoma and Austin Shepherd in the seventh round from Alabama. After acquiring middle linebacker Eric Kendricks and defensive end Danielle Hunter on Friday, they took defensive end B.J. Dubose from Louisville and outside linebacker Edmond Robinson from Division II Newberry College on Saturday.

The Vikings took Southern Illinois tight end MyCole Pruitt and Maryland wide receiver Stefon Diggs in the fifth round.

First-rounder Trae Waynes was the only defensive back the Vikings drafted.
